Coux is a commune of the Ardèche department in southern France.
Population
| Historical population | ||
|---|---|---|
| Year | Pop. | ±% |
| 1962 | 780 | — |
| 1968 | 806 | +3.3% |
| 1975 | 953 | +18.2% |
| 1982 | 1,418 | +48.8% |
| 1990 | 1,501 | +5.9% |
| 1999 | 1,464 | −2.5% |
| 2008 | 1,631 | +11.4% |
